I just picked up a 1965 American 440. Want to know if I can slap on a power booster and perhaps convert front to disks. Have done it with aftermarket packages on a 68 Mustang but not sure if they exist for this car. Thanks

Answer
You can add power brakes by using a booster/master cylinder from another AMC that will fit. Try a Gremlin or Hornet. Disc brakes are a bit different. You have to find disc brakes from a 69 or earlier AMC. In 1970, AMC changed from a front suspension with a trunnion to having ball joints.
The two suspensions are not interchangable.

Let me give you additional information.
You can use later model disc brakes from a Gremlin, Concord or Hornet. Just use the late model spindles and the disc brakes should bolt up. Use a booster from the Gremlin, Concord or Hornet, along with the proportionong valve.
